Grasping the Expense of Stem Cell Treatment: What to Expect and How to Prepare
Stem cell treatment holds immense possibilities for addressing a wide range of ailments. However, the financial burden of these treatments can be substantial, often causing patients to carefully consider their alternatives.
Before embarking stem cell treatment, it is crucial to gain a thorough awareness of the connected costs.
Elements that can impact the overall expense include:
* The kind of stem cells used
* The complexity of the illness being addressed
* The extent of the treatment plan
* The site where the treatment is carried out
* Any additional costs, such as travel and prescription drugs.

Affordable Stem Cell Injection Options: Exploring Financing and Insurance Coverage
Stem cell injections present a revolutionary approach to managing a variety of medical conditions. However, the price of these procedures can be a significant barrier for many individuals. Fortunately, there are multiple funding options available to make stem cell injections more reachable.
Some centers offer in-house financing programs, allowing patients to pay for their treatment over time. Furthermore, external financing companies concentrate in funding medical procedures, including stem cell injections. It's important to carefully compare different financing packages to find the best fit for your circumstances.
